Output 3d35532ab3a395da103934acb38bd1640859a592e102d5786c10ce91acf80ed3:68

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c608a94e2b8b886d7f4cde988a6bbf67fe819bbcd5e5428f066bbee15d15ff68
address
bc1pccy2jn3t3wyx6l6vm6vg56alvllgrxau6hj59rcxdwlwzhg4la5q844ja5
transaction
3d35532ab3a395da103934acb38bd1640859a592e102d5786c10ce91acf80ed3
spent
true